About the role

AI summarised

We are seeking a senior Network Engineer with at least 5 years of experience to design, implement, and maintain enterprise-level network infrastructure for a key customer in Singapore. The role requires deep expertise in core networking technologies including load balancers, routing/switching, next-gen firewalls, cloud network security, and application gateways, with hands-on experience in F5, Cisco, Check Point, Palo Alto, and Azure. The ideal candidate holds a CCNP certification and is a Singaporean citizen due to security clearance requirements.

Key Responsibilities

  • Design, implement, and maintain enterprise-level network infrastructure
  • Configure and manage F5 BIG-IP load balancers for application delivery, SSL offloading, and traffic management
  • Configure and troubleshoot Cisco IOS and Nexus series routing and switching, including OSPF, BGP, EIGRP, and VLANs
  • Configure and manage Check Point and Palo Alto Networks next-generation firewalls, including policy management and threat prevention
  • Design and implement Azure Firewall in Azure environments, applying cloud-native network security best practices
  • Configure and manage Azure Application Gateway, including web application firewall (WAF) implementation
  • Implement and manage intrusion detection/prevention systems (IDPS), including configuring, tuning, and maintaining rules and policies
  • Analyze IDPS logs and respond to security incidents
  • Configure and manage site-to-site and remote access VPNs using Cisco AnyConnect and Palo Alto GlobalProtect
  • Perform CIS hardening on network devices and conduct security assessments and remediation
